Chair 5 and the trails around it were almost deserted. We had the place to ourselves. Even the tailgating scene was super low key

IMG_8706.jpeg


Of course, the best terrain is not accessible off of Chair 5 so we eventually made our way back. Chair 4 had a line but it wasn’t bad- 5 to 10 minutes at most. All the snowmaking terrain was in good shape. Hercules had a few loud spots but nothing really icy. Some of the natural was a bit firm but nothing to complain about.

IMG_8746.jpeg


IMG_8856.jpeg


We did cycle back through the main base area once or twice. One great thing about Greek is that it has a great learning area with a really slow chair and some carpets.
